Nancy E. Preston, 87, of Walnutport, passed away Sunday, July 16, 2023, at St. Luke’s Carbon Campus.   She was the wife of Joseph Preston, whom she married on December 5, 1970.   Born in Hamburg on January 20, 1936, she was the daughter of the late Charles Correll and Dorothy (Degler) Hepner.   Nancy worked as a district secretary for Electrolux for many years.    Following her retirement from Electrolux, Nancy worked as a nanny for several years.     She was a member of the Carbon County Quilters Guild and enjoyed taking trips to the casinos.

In addition to her husband Joe, she will be lovingly remembered by a son: Larry Fryer and wife Sandy of Woodstock, MD; daughter: Joy Morris of Bethlehem, PA; grandchildren: Keith & Randy; brothers: Robert Correll of Sinking Spring, Barry Correll and wife Lori of Kempton; sister: Carolyn Hartman of Bernville; sister-in-law: Eileen Correll; mother-in-law: Josephine Preston and many other extended relatives of the Preston family.  She was predeceased by a brother, Charles Correll.  

A Celebration of Life will be held at 1PM on Friday, August 18, 2023, at the Walnutport Canal Pavilion, 309 Lehigh Street, Walnutport PA..  Arrangements are being handled by Harding Funeral Home, Slatington.   In lieu of flowers, donations can be made to the Leukemia Society.
